The video explores various cosmic phenomena and their potential impacts on Earth. It discusses gamma ray bursts, asteroid threats, and supernovae, highlighting the risks they pose. The video also covers the future of Earth as the Sun evolves into a red giant, predicting the eventual engulfment of the inner planets. Strategies for mitigating asteroid impacts and understanding stellar explosions are also examined.
